Runbook: Skylark crash-report pipeline, plugin intake. If your plugin's crash symbols fail to resolve, confirm the symbol bundle was uploaded before the crash batch closed — late uploads are ignored, not queued. Re-upload triggers reprocessing within one hour. Do not resubmit crash payloads directly. Reference the ingest build identified by the token below.

pipeline stamp: htk3_69f

Runbook: Account Recovery — Quellit API. During the March audit we traced elevated recovery latency to an N+1 GraphQL pattern: each account lookup triggered separate resolver calls for linked identities. We batched these via a dataloader in the recovery service, cutting query count from ~400 to 3 per request. No authorization logic changed; scopes are still checked per identity. To unlock the staging recovery vault for verification, use the passphrase below.

recovery phrase for bawef-kagug: casix-tamvan-lamath-holeth-gilmir-drudor-julax-wenok-wenael-rusvan-holax-goriel-frawyn

Runbook: Account recovery — Lanewise Autocomplete

For the on-call engineer: if the service account for the Lanewise address autocomplete widget is locked out, first confirm the lockout in the auth audit view, then pause the suggestion pipeline to avoid stale cache writes. Recovery requires unsealing the widget's credential store, which accepts only the recovery passphrase below.

unlock words, kagef-taduf: fenir-quenix-norwyn-sorvan-gormir-gorir-fraok

Re: thumbnail queue PR — mostly looks good, but flagging for the sync since these numbers affect everyone downstream. The Hollowframe worker now drains the thumbnail queue in larger batches, which is great for throughput but risks starving the priority lane during upload spikes. I'd rather we agree on batch size and backoff as a team than tweak them per-service again. For discussion, the proposed constants are below.

limits module of kagep-kagug:
QUOTAS = {
    "wenael": 10,
    "wenwyn": 2,
}